Gisèle Bündchen set to get Max Factor contract, says source

February 16, 2008/11.27

Brazilian supermodel Gisèle Bündchen may have scored a two-year, $2·5 million contract to be the face of Max Factor, according to E! News.    The entertainment news service quotes a source close to the deal, saying that the campaign will break in the summer.    Bündchen is the highest-earning model in the world at the […]

Australian actor Heath Ledger, 28, found dead

January 22, 2008/23.17

Australian-born, Oscar-nominated actor Heath Ledger, 28, has been found dead in a Soho, New York apartment.    The New York Police Department has confirmed his death. NYPD spokesman Paul Browne said Ledger was found by a housekeeper at 3.26 p.m., who went to tell him that a masseuse had arrived for an appointment. ‘We don’t know the cause of the […]

Van Cleef & Arpel sues Heidi Klum, Mouawad

December 23, 2007/3.16

Reuter reports that Van Cleef & Arpel ?led a lawsuit in New York last Friday against Heidi Klum GmbH and Mouawad USA, alleging that its Alhambra clover design had been copied and that the companies bene?ted from its reputation. Van Cleef & Arpel claims $25,000.    In copyright, the plaintiff has the onus in proving objective […]
